Lakers super team has floundered thus far. M Brown was sacked after a terrible 0-8 preseason, and 1-4 start to the season. Nash got injured after game 2, and M D'Antoni was hired after that. Lakers record after 33 games, 15-18. They will have to go 35-14 (or 6-7 wins out of ten) the rest of way to just qualify for the playoffs. This is worse than 03-04. Howard needs to shoulder most of the blame for this. His numbers are very good and when he's paying attention, he's tremendous (26 rebs against Denver, whilst playing with a torn shoulder muscle). But his lack to effort is either down to his recovery from his back injury, or pure laziness. I'd like to think it's his injuries, but he's shown enough power and strength in some games to say otherwsie. I hope his head turns around soon enough, else the Lakers are looking at the lottery.
